Synergos is a global non-profit organization solving complex issues and deeply entrenched societal problems around the world by advancing Bridging Leadership, a style of leadership which builds trust and collective action. Our experience over the last 35 years in more than 30 countries tells us that collaboration, shared vision and deeper understanding releases more and better solutions than working alone. Today we help dismantle systems that create the most urgent problems of our time: poverty, social injustice, and climate change.

Our work has employed our Bridging Leadership methodology in a variety of areas: drowning prevention in Bangladesh, leadership development in Ethiopia, agricultural development in Nigeria, youth entrepreneurship in MENA, maternal health in Namibia, teen empowerment in South Africa, and non-profit capacity building in Brazil. Further we work with innovative networks of game-changers, social entrepreneurs and thought leaders to promote and execute our mission.
